Introduction to Fiber Laser Technology


Fiber laser technology has transformed the metal cutting industry by providing a faster, cleaner, and more efficient alternative to older methods such as plasma cutting and CO₂ lasers. A fiber laser operates by channeling a high-intensity beam of light through an optical fiber, producing a concentrated energy source that cuts through metals with extreme precision.

The Fiber Laser Aluminum Cutting Machine is specifically engineered to handle challenging materials like aluminum, which is known for its reflective properties. By combining high power with advanced optics and CNC controls, it ensures that aluminum and other metals can be cut smoothly and efficiently without compromising quality.

Power Options for Flexibility


The availability of 1.5kW and 3kW power levels allows this machine to serve both small-scale operations and larger industrial facilities.

The 1.5kW configuration is ideal for cutting thin to medium sheets of aluminum, stainless steel, and mild steel. It offers efficiency for industries focused on signage, decorative panels, or lightweight components.

The 3kW configuration adds extra cutting strength for thicker materials and more complex projects. This makes it suitable for heavy-duty applications such as machinery components, construction materials, and automotive parts.

By offering two different power levels, the machine provides flexibility for businesses to match their production needs without overspending on unnecessary capacity.

Advantages Over Traditional Methods


Compared to traditional cutting methods like plasma or CO₂ lasers, fiber laser technology offers numerous advantages.

Higher energy efficiency reduces power consumption and operating costs.

Faster cutting speeds increase production capacity.

Superior edge quality minimizes the need for finishing.

Ability to cut reflective metals like aluminum without damaging the system.

Lower maintenance requirements ensure long-term cost savings.

These benefits make fiber laser cutting the preferred choice for industries aiming to stay competitive in today’s fast-paced market.
